Icu Medical capital expenditures (capex) trends

Over the last five fiscal years, Icu Medical's capital expenditures (capex) decreased from $92.0M to $88.0M, a change of −$4.0M. The latest reported quarter, Q2 2026, shows $18.5M.

What capital expenditures (CapEx) mean

Capital expenditures, commonly called CapEx, are cash investments in long-lived assets such as property, plants, equipment, infrastructure, and productive software. CapEx can support future growth or maintain existing operations, but it reduces current-period free cash flow.
